About the journal

|
The Journal of Korean Religions (JKR), the only English-language academic journal dedicated to the study of Korean religions, was launched in the autumn of 2010. It aims to stimulate interest in and discuss the study of Korean religions in various academic disciplines within the humanities and social sciences. A peer-reviewed journal, JKR is published twice a year, in April and October. The journal publishes articles of original research, review articles, book reviews, and current issues which seek to discuss, elaborate and extend the study of Korean religions. Its main concern lies in advancing theoretical and philosophical understanding, as well as promoting more concrete and empirical analyses of Korean religions.
JKR is indexed in the Thomson Reuters Arts & Humanities Citation Index, as well as Current Contents/Arts and Humanities, SCOPUS, and ATLAS. Our digital publication is available on Project MUSE. |
